Dr. Tsutomu Osaka is a pioneering researcher in robotic vision and human-robot interaction, with a focus on biomimetic active vision systems. His most-cited work, the 2006 paper "Face Tracking Active Vision System with Saccadic and Smooth Pursuit," introduced a novel robotic vision module that emulates human eye movements—rapid saccades and smooth pursuit—to achieve fast, robust face tracking. By integrating robust face detection with color histogram-based tracking, Dr. Osaka's system enables real-time, dynamic tracking critical for surveillance and interactive robotics.
